Erin E Powell is a scholar working on Environmental Engineering, Molecular Biology and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Erin E Powell has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 407 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Environmental Engineering, 4 papers in Molecular Biology and 4 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Erin E Powell's work include Microbial Fuel Cells and Bioremediation (5 papers),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(3 papers) and Genomics, phytochemicals, and oxidative stress (2 papers). Erin E Powell is often cited by papers focused on Microbial Fuel Cells and Bioremediation (5 papers),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(3 papers) and Genomics, phytochemicals, and oxidative stress (2 papers). Erin E Powell collaborates with scholars based in Canada and United States. Erin E Powell's co-authors include Gordon A. Hill, Richard W. Evitts, Ajay K. Dalai, Ramin Azargohar, M. Schnitzer, Danielle Julie Carrier, Carlos M. Monreal, Bernhard H.J. Juurlink and T.G. Crowe and has published in prestigious journals such as Bioresource Technology, Energy and Journal of Analytical and Applied Pyrolysis.
